SPRINGFIELD, Mass. (July 15, 2016) – Western New England University cornerback Obi Etuka (Middletown, Conn.) is among 165 nominees for the 2016 Allstate American Football Coaches Association (AFCA) Good Works Team, it was announced on Wednesday.

Now in its 25th year, the Good Works Team recognizes college football players that have "made a commitment to service and enriching the lives of others."

Etuka, who will be entering his senior season in 2016, helped lead Western New England to a 10-0 regular season, the team's second New England Football Conference (NEFC) title, and an appearance in the NCAA Tournament last fall.

The Middletown, Conn. native totaled five interceptions and ten pass breakups on his way to NEFC Defensive Player of the Year, D3football.com All-East Region, and New England Football Writers All-New England accolades.

Off the field, Etuka and the rest of the Western New England football team have been active in a community service initiative called Revitalize Community Development Corp (Revitalize CDC), in which they perform repairs, rehabilitations and modifications on the homes of low income families, as well as families with military veterans, special needs individuals, and elderly people in Springfield.

In honor of the 25th anniversary, Allstate and the AFCA will add three additional spots to this year's team and announce a final roster of 25 members in September. For the first time in the award's history, the Allstate AFCA Good Works Team® will be comprised of 12 players from the NCAA Football Bowl Subdivision, 12 players from the NCAA Football Championship Subdivision, Divisions II, III and the NAIA and an honorary head coach.

Once the final team members are announced in September, fans are encouraged to visit the Allstate AFCA Good Works Team® website on ESPN.com, featuring profiles and images of the players, for the opportunity to vote for the 2016 Allstate AFCA Good Works Team® Captain.

In order to meet the criteria set forth by Allstate and the AFCA, each player must be actively involved with a charitable organization or service group while maintaining a strong academic standing.
